Creator's Key Takeaways

Before you touch a single soda or water bottle, take out your phone and take a clear timestamped photo of the mini bar.

The TV remote is statistically the filthiest object in any cabin.

Most people head straight to the buffet after boarding. It's familiar, fast, and open. But I've learned that skipping it on day one is one of the smartest moves I can make.

Smart cruisers explore early so they cruise better all week long.

Creator's Tips & Advice

Take a timestamped photo of the minibar before unpacking to avoid phantom charges.
Cover the TV remote with a Ziploc bag to avoid germs.
Inspect mattress seams for bed bugs before unpacking.
Test the safe code with the door open before locking valuables.
Check shower water pressure and drainage immediately.
Use magnetic hooks to maximize counter space.
